27-113 - Definitions applying to homeownership affordable housing LAST AMENDED 12/5/2024 Eligible buyer An “eligible buyer” is a #household# that qualifies to buy a specific #homeownership# #affordable housing unit#. Such a #household# shall, except as otherwise provided in the #guidelines#: (a) be, at the time of application for an initial sale or resale of an #affordable housing unit#, a #household# that satisfies the #income band# applicable to such unit; and (b) meet such additional eligibility requirements as may be specified in the #guidelines#. Homeowner A “homeowner” is a person or persons who: (a) owns a condominium #homeownership# #affordable housing unit# and occupies such condominium #homeownership# #affordable housing unit# in accordance with owner occupancy requirements set forth in the #guidelines#; or (b) owns shares in a #cooperative corporation#, holds a proprietary lease for a #homeownership# #affordable housing unit# owned by such #cooperative corporation# and occupies such #homeownership# #affordable housing unit# in accordance with owner occupancy requirements set forth in the #guidelines#. Homeownership “Homeownership” is a form of tenure for housing, including #dwelling units# occupied by either the owner as a separate condominium, a shareholder in a cooperative corporation pursuant to the terms of a proprietary lease, a #grandfathered tenant# or an authorized subletter pursuant to the #guidelines#.
